最近把lcn4.0版本更新到5.0版本后,出現一個問題: LCN4.0版本在客戶端啟動時如果找不到tx-manager,默認會一直重試,但更新到5.0版本后默認只會重試8次,並且無法設置無限重試。 這樣就限制了客戶端要在tx-manager之前啟動,並且如果lcn沒有集群,並且掛了的話,啟動 ...
最新在更新LCN,由 . 更新到了 . ,這里說說更新遇到的問題,官方在 . . 版本開始兼容了springboot . 版本,但是整合的時候還是需要注意一些問題。 .maven的引包需要改變,本人使用的是最新的 . . 版本 .代碼需要做一些改變 a.啟動類需要加上 EnableDistributedTransaction注解 b.用到了分布式事務的方法上注解由 TxtTransaction改為 ...
2019-03-27 10:15 0 1835 推薦指數:
最近把lcn4.0版本更新到5.0版本后,出現一個問題: LCN4.0版本在客戶端啟動時如果找不到tx-manager,默認會一直重試,但更新到5.0版本后默認只會重試8次,並且無法設置無限重試。 這樣就限制了客戶端要在tx-manager之前啟動,並且如果lcn沒有集群,並且掛了的話,啟動 ...
前面介紹了Boot 1.5版本集成Neo4j,Boot 2.0以上版本Neo4j變化較大。 場景還是電影人員關系 Boot 2.0主要變化 GraphRepository在Boot2.0下不支持了,調整為Neo4jRepository。 對應的findById ...
spring boot 2.0.3啟動報錯: 解決之路: 首先,在啟動類上添加注解@EnableAutoConfiguration 或 @SpringBootApplication 這種 解決方案 ,都是無效的 其次,maven編譯install這個spring boot ...
1.項目基礎 項目是基於Spring Boot2.x版本的 2.添加依賴 3.yml配置 application-quartz.yml的配置內容如下 4.創建任務測試類 簡單任務 代碼 ...
背景介紹 公司最近的新項目在進行技術框架升級,基於的Spring Boot的版本是2.0.2,整合Redis數據庫。網上基於2.X版本的整個Redis少之又少,中間踩了不少坑,特此把整合過程記錄,以供小伙伴們參考。 本文的基於在於會搭建Spring Boot項目的基礎上進行的,入門是小白的話 ...
from http://www.jianshu.com/p/a313ffd19a2e 隨着spring boot 1.5版本的發布,在spring項目中與kafka集成更為簡便。 引入依賴 <dependency> <groupId> ...
對比LCN和saga(華為apache孵化器項目) ,LCN使用代理連接池封裝補償方法,saga需要手工寫補償方法,相對來說LCN使用更加方便。 參考官方地址: https://github.com/codingapi/tx-lcn/wiki/TxManager%E5%90%AF%E5 ...
1 首先在 本地搭建一個虛擬機,安裝mysql 2 對mysql 單表數據量測試 這里使用spring boot 配合durid 和 mybatis 來搭建 ,下面會詳細介紹 這里先 貼上 pom,因為前段時間 在對比 postgre,mongodb 等數據庫,pom里面還有一些 ...